Solar Batteries Moorebank, NSW 2170
The 2170 postcode, which includes Moorebank, Casula, Casula Mall, Chipping Norton, Hammondville, Liverpool, Liverpool South, Liverpool Westfield, Lurnea, Mount Pritchard, Prestons and Warwick Farm, has 39,025 households. Of these, 11,352 homes — or 29.1% — have installed rooftop solar panels, reflecting the community's growing move toward renewable energy. According to daily average sunshine data from the nearest weather station at Liverpool(whitlam Centre), households in this community receive approximately 4.5 kWh of sunlight per day. Across 2170, rooftop solar systems collectively generate approximately 120,718,000 kWh of clean energy each year, based on an average system size of 7.6 kW. At current electricity rates, that's equivalent to around $36,215,400 of clean energy at grid electricity costs annually.
